Analysis

Australia recorded 64.1% for proportion of students at the end of primary education achieving at in 2023.

The figure is up 1.8% over ten years.

Over the whole period, proportion of students at the end of primary education achieving at in Australia peaked at 74.0% in 1999 and was at its lowest, 60.8%, in 2007.

That places Australia 21st out of 29 countries with data for 2023, putting it in the middle of the range.

Proportion of students at the end of primary education achieving at in Australia, year by year

Annual values for Proportion of students at the end of primary education achieving at least a minimum proficiency level in mathematics, both sexes (%) in Australia, 1995 to 2023.
Year % Change
1995 66.4%
1999 74.0% +11.5%
2003 64.9% -12.3%
2007 60.8% -6.3%
2011 62.9% +3.5%
2015 64.4% +2.4%
2019 68.0% +5.5%
2023 64.1% -5.7%
